Quick 'N Easy Sausage Casserole
A hearty and cheesy sausage casserole combining potatoes, mushrooms, celery, and a creamy sauce, perfect for a comforting family dinner or casual gathering.
Ingredients
Instructions
- Combine potatoes, mushrooms, celery, condensed cream soup, and 1/2 cup shredded cheese in a bowl.
- Spoon the mixture into a buttered 1 1/2-quart casserole or baking dish.
- Arrange Brown 'N Serve sausage atop the casserole.
- Sprinkle the remaining 1/2 cup cheese over the top.
- Bake in a 350°F oven for 35 to 40 minutes until hot and bubbly.
Tips & Substitutions
For a creamier texture, consider adding a touch of sour cream or Greek yogurt to the mixture. If you're out of cheddar cheese, feel free to substitute with mozzarella or a blend of your favorite cheeses. You can also add some spices like paprika or garlic powder to enhance the flavor.
Serving Suggestions
This sausage casserole is hearty enough to stand alone but pairs beautifully with a fresh green salad or steamed vegetables for a complete meal. For a comforting breakfast, consider serving it alongside Scrambled Eggs Casserole. A dollop of hot sauce can also add a nice kick.
Storage & Reheating
Leftover sausage casserole can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to three days. To reheat, cover with foil and warm in a preheated oven at 350°F for about 20 minutes, or microwave in short intervals until heated through.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I use different types of sausage?
Absolutely! Feel free to use any sausage you prefer, whether it's Italian, turkey, or even a plant-based option. Just make sure to cook it according to the package instructions before adding it to the casserole for the best flavor and texture.
Can I make this dish ahead of time?
Yes, you can prepare the casserole in advance by assembling it and then covering it tightly with plastic wrap. Store it in the refrigerator for up to 24 hours before baking. Just add a few extra minutes to the baking time if it's coming straight from the fridge.
What can I add for extra vegetables?
You can add a variety of vegetables such as bell peppers, spinach, or even broccoli to the casserole for added nutrition and flavor. Just chop them up and mix them in with the other ingredients before baking.
